Eligibility for Revision Rhinoplasty
The eligibility for revision rhinoplasty depends on several factors, including the time elapsed since the initial surgery, the nature of the complications, and the patient's overall health. Generally, it is advisable to wait at least a year after the primary rhinoplasty to allow for complete healing and settling of the tissues. During a consultation, a qualified surgeon will assess your specific case to determine if you are a suitable candidate for revision rhinoplasty.
The Surgical Process
The surgical process for revision rhinoplasty is often more intricate than primary rhinoplasty due to the presence of scar tissue and altered anatomy. The surgeon will carefully plan the procedure to address the specific concerns of the patient. This may involve cartilage grafting, tissue reconstruction, or structural adjustments to achieve the desired outcome. The goal is to enhance both the functional and aesthetic aspects of the nose.

The Procedure
The revision rhinoplasty process begins with a thorough consultation where the surgeon evaluates the patient's medical history and the previous surgery's outcomes. Imaging techniques may be used to visualize the desired changes. The surgery itself involves making incisions, often inside the nose to minimize visible scarring, and then reshaping the cartilage and bone to achieve the desired result. The procedure can take several hours, depending on the complexity of the case.
Recovery and Results
Recovery from revision rhinoplasty can be more extensive than from the initial surgery. Swelling and bruising are common and may take several weeks to subside. Patients are typically advised to take time off work and avoid strenuous activities during this period. The final results may not be visible for several months as the swelling fully resolves.
